Sustainability that means business


Who we are:

Sustainability software specialist, AMCS, is headquartered in Ireland, with offices in Europe, the USA, and Australasia. With over 1,300 highly-skilled employees across 22 countries, we specialize in delivering technology solutions to facilitate a carbon neutral future.

 

What we do:

Our innovative SaaS solutions increase efficiency and boost sustainability in resource-intensive industries. Over 5,000 customers across 23 countries already benefit from our Performance Sustainability software, ensuring we deliver practical solutions for improved profitability and environmental resilience across the globe.


Our people:

AMCS offers team members more than just a job, but an opportunity to map out a career with a company that is growing, evolving and setting out new ways of working that are having a positive impact on the world around us. AMCS was established in Ireland and holds onto those local roots and ‘start-up’ mentality with a culture of connection. Connection to our work, our customers, our colleagues and our community that creates a working environment that fosters openness, collaboration and creativity.


We are looking for a proficient Senior Backend Developer to join our global, cross-functional Agile team. This individual will take lead in refining our EHS software product through efficient API development, API versioning, and robust quality assurance practices. The successful candidate will exhibit strong skills in observability and operational awareness, mentorship of team members, and ability to work seamlessly within multicultural, remote teams.

 

Responsibilities:

 

1. Lead backend development efforts with a focus on developing, enhancing, and versioning of dedicated APIs.

2. Implement and advocate for test-driven development and quality assurance strategies to ensure high-quality software deployment.

3. Foster a culture of observability and operational awareness in development processes, promoting understanding and optimization of system behaviour.

4. Contribute significantly to requirements engineering and solution proposal processes, employing your technical expertise and problem-solving skills.

5. Mentor and guide junior developers, nurturing their technical and soft skills, and cultivating a positive team environment.

6. Engage in software architecture discussions, reinforcing best practices in backend software design.

7. Work effectively with remote, Agile teams spread across different locations and time zones, demonstrating empathy and cultural awareness.

8. Drive continuous integration and improvement efforts within the team, encouraging innovative thinking and efficient practices.

9. Oversee and resolve backend-related issues, safeguarding the stability and functionality of our software products.

 

Qualifications:

 

1. Proven experience as a Senior Backend Developer or similar role.

2. Solid experience with backend technologies such as PHP, Symfony, SQL, and a strong grasp on API development and versioning.

3. Proficient in test-driven development and quality assurance methodologies.

4. Experience in fostering a culture of observability and operational awareness in development processes.

5. Sound understanding of Agile methodologies and continuous integration in software development.

6. Experience in mentoring and leading technical teams.

7. Excellent problem-solving skills with outstanding verbal and written communication capabilities.

8. High level of empathy and cultural awareness, with experience in working with diverse, global teams.

9. A keen learner with the ability to adapt in a rapidly evolving tech environment.

Apply for position now